Application Manager
Location: Hybrid (3 days per week from the office in Tricity, Warsaw, or Łódź)
Rate: up to 85 PLN / hour net + VAT
Contract Type: B2B (Cooperation agreement signed directly with Optiveum)
About the role:
We are currently recruiting an Application Manager (SME) for our Client, a leading international organization. In this role, you will take ownership of the lifecycle, stability, and continuous improvement of a business-critical data and reporting solution that supports the DORA Register of Information.
You will ensure the reliable performance of procurement-related systems while driving the optimization of data flows, increasing automation, and implementing scalable improvements.
Your responsibilities:
Managing the full application lifecycle and ensuring system stability.
Handling incident, problem, and change management support.
Coordinating cross-functional activities with various stakeholders and vendors.
Optimizing systems, data flows, and processes while increasing automation.
Guaranteeing application compliance and maintaining accurate documentation.
Ensuring reporting reliability and contributing to scalable, future-state solution designs.
Leading and contributing to multiple application-related projects simultaneously.
Must-have requirements:
Proven experience in application lifecycle and application management.
Background in systems administration, preferably as a Business Systems Analyst or IT Analyst within procurement.
Hands-on experience with Snowflake, Power BI, data quality, and reporting.
Strong skills in incident, problem, and change management.
Technical troubleshooting and analytical problem-solving skills.
High awareness of risk, security, and compliance.
Excellent stakeholder management, vendor coordination, and collaboration skills.
Project management experience or equivalent background in driving cross-functional activities.
Advanced, professional English communication skills across all organizational and seniority levels.
Nice-to-have:
Knowledge of DORA or third-party risk management.
Experience in automating recurring reporting processes.
Understanding of procurement or supplier data.
Experience with requirements, process mapping, and prioritization.
A continuous improvement mindset with scalable solution design experience.
What we offer:
Long-term cooperation based on a B2B contract signed directly with Optiveum.
The opportunity to work on business-critical systems for a global enterprise.
A flexible hybrid working model.
